Can photographic evidence of a candidate’s work with service users and children be presented as evidence within a portfolio?

0

Under no circumstances should photographs of service users or children be included within candidate portfolios – even if faces are obscured. Centres must advise candidates of the need to protect service users and children’s privacy within their evidence collection.
